OnePlus 13T vs. iPhone 15 Pro Max: A Head-to-Head Flagship Battle

The OnePlus 13T arrives as a performance-focused Android contender, directly challenging Apple’s established dominance with the iPhone 15 Pro Max. This isn’t simply a spec-sheet comparison; it’s a clash of ecosystems, chip architectures, and user philosophies. We’ll break down where each phone excels, and for whom.
Phones Images

🏆 Quick Verdict

For the average user prioritizing a seamless ecosystem and long-term software support, the iPhone 15 Pro Max remains the superior choice. However, the OnePlus 13T delivers exceptional raw performance with its Snapdragon 8 Elite and significantly faster charging, making it ideal for power users and mobile gamers.

Performance

The core of this battle lies in the chipsets. The OnePlus 13T’s Snapdragon 8 Elite (3nm) features an octa-core configuration with Oryon V2 Phoenix cores – a design focused on maximizing single-core and multi-core performance. The iPhone 15 Pro Max’s A17 Pro (3nm) utilizes a hexa-core architecture. Despite having fewer cores, Apple’s chip design and software optimization consistently deliver exceptional performance. The Snapdragon 8 Elite’s architecture suggests a focus on sustained performance, potentially benefiting long gaming sessions. The 13T’s LPDDR5x RAM will contribute to fast data access, but Apple’s memory bandwidth optimization is a significant advantage. Thermal management will be critical; the Snapdragon 8 Elite’s efficiency will be tested under sustained load.

Buying Guide

Buy the OnePlus 13T if you need uncompromising speed for demanding tasks like video editing or gaming, and value incredibly fast 80W wired charging. You’re also getting a more open Android experience. Buy the Apple iPhone 15 Pro Max if you prioritize a polished, integrated ecosystem, industry-leading camera video capabilities, and guaranteed software updates for years to come. The iPhone’s longevity and resale value are also key advantages.
